Registered Veterinary Technician Manager

This is an excellent opportunity for a skilled RVT leader who enjoys balancing hands-on patient care with team leadership, workflow management, and staff development in a collaborative general practice environment.

In this role, you will:
  • Oversee daily hospital flow and help ensure efficient, high-quality patient care throughout the day
  • Delegate tasks appropriately to support workflow efficiency and team success
  • Support onboarding, training, and continued development of clinical support staff
  • Create and manage staff schedules based on the needs of the business
  • Assist the Hospital Manager with annual performance reviews and coaching conversations
  • Assist with recruiting, candidate screening, and hiring support staff team members
  • Help manage inventory and maintain appropriate stock levels for hospital operations
  • Support veterinarians and clinical staff during outpatient appointments, surgery, and dental procedures as needed
  • Foster a positive, accountable, team-oriented culture focused on excellent patient and client care

Schedule:

This is a full-time position with flexible scheduling availability required, including Saturdays, to support the needs of the hospital. Shifts are typically scheduled as 4/10s between 8am-6pm.

Full-time benefits and compensation**:
  • Compensation: $42-45 per hour, for each hour worked*
  • Bonus package: $2,000
  • CE allowance: up to $1,000 annually based on tenure
  • Health package: Medical, dental, and vision insurance with HSA option and choice of United Healthcare or Kaiser Permanente
  • Competitive PTO Policy: Vacation accrual starting at 80 hours per year (based on full-time hours worked), plus CA paid sick leave
  • Life insurance, disability, and 401k options
  • Employee Assistance Program
  • Personal pet discount
  • Uniform allowance
  • Our break room is well stocked with your favorite treats and drinks!

Minimum qualifications and skill set:
  • Current Registered Veterinary Technician License in the state of California
  • 5+ years of veterinary clinical experience is required
  • Previous Supervisor or Management experience is required
  • Strong understanding of hospital workflow, patient care standards, and team delegation
  • Experience training and mentoring veterinary support staff
  • Comfortable navigating difficult conversations while maintaining a positive team environment
  • Proficiency in the following skills:
    • Venipuncture and cystocentesis
    • Placing IV catheters and administering injections
    • Anesthetic induction and monitoring
    • Dental prophylaxis and radiographs
